Sitting along the western shores of Lake Ontario, Burlington is a beautiful waterfront city sandwiched between Hamilton and Oakville. With Toronto just 57 kilometres to the east, Burlington is a comparatively relaxed environment offering a comfortable lifestyle and a great sense of community. Along with Milton to the north, Burlington forms the west end of the Greater Toronto Area, and is also part of the Hamilton metropolitan census area

Buying a Home in Burlington. Being a city between a lake and an escarpment, many properties in Burlington come with beautiful views as well as convenient access to numerous recreational activities. Burlington condos and townhomes are increasingly becoming a popular option for new home buyers, with luxury options available along the lakeshore. A wide selection of single-family home options are available from century properties near downtown, to newer developments as the city has expanded.

Brant and Maple include downtown shops, restaurants and attractions closer to the waterfront.  Newer condo and townhome developments mix with historic residential neighbourhoods to create a walkable urban charm.  Rich in culture, this part of the city contains dining choices from Persian to Mediterranean cuisine and hosts many of the city’s festivals.  The downtown core is the more vibrant part of the city with live events at The Burlington Performing Arts Centre as well as its Farmer’s Market in Centro Garden.
